
Rockler Doweling Jigs
Rockler Woodworking and Hardware's new Doweling Jigs make
it easier than ever to drill straight, centered holes for dowel joinery without having to use a drill press.
Available in three sizes, 1/4", 3/8", and 1/2", the doweling jigs deliver joint setups for hand drilling
in just seconds. The 3/16" thick transparent acrylic faces eliminate the need for transfering multiple
marks from the jig to stock, making it possible to line up the jig, clamp it to the stock, and start
drilling. Hardened steel drill guides ensure drill bits are centered and won't wander during the drilling
process, resulting in perfectly aligned, perfectly centered, hand-drilled dowel holes.

The ability to drill accurate dowel holes is a key ingredient to making strong, simple joints. With a
Rockler Doweling Jig, woodworkers are able to create pefectly mated holes for panel glue-ups,
substituting complicated mortise-and-tenon joints with easy dowel joints, and creating stable joints in
tight spaces where traditional joinery might not fit.
Rockler Doweling Jigs are made from durable, 3/16" acrylic faces and hardened steel drill guides
with evenly spaced guide holes. The 1/4" and 3/8" jigs have holes spaced 3/4"-on-center, while the
1/2" guide has holes spaced 1"-on-center.
